From 0e3291c2672e7cabcf56a8ecb3a9a6172993cbe3 Mon Sep 17 00:00:00 2001 From: Rahul Thakur Date: Mon, 3 Apr 2023 17:22:44 +0530 Subject: [PATCH] libdsl: update makefile --- libdsl/Makefile |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/libdsl/Makefile b/libdsl/Makefile index 8698601a0..50e0fb6b8 100644 --- a/libdsl/Makefile +++ b/libdsl/Makefile @@ -23,6 +23,20 @@ PKG_LICENSE_FILES:=LICENSE include $(INCLUDE_DIR)/package.mk +ifeq ($(CONFIG_TARGET_brcmbca),y) + TARGET_PLATFORM=BROADCOM + CHIP_ID=$(patsubst "%",%,$(CONFIG_BCM_CHIP_ID)) + TARGET_CFLAGS +=-DIOPSYS_BROADCOM -DCHIP_$(CHIP_ID) -DCONFIG_BCM9$(CHIP_ID) \ + -I$(STAGING_DIR)/usr/include/bcm963xx/bcmdrivers/opensource/include/bcm963xx \ + -I$(STAGING_DIR)/usr/include/bcm963xx/userspace/public/include +else ifeq ($(CONFIG_TARGET_iopsys_x86),y) + TARGET_PLATFORM=TEST + TARGET_CFLAGS +=-DIOPSYS_TEST +else ifeq ($(CONFIG_TARGET_iopsys_armvirt),y) + TARGET_PLATFORM=TEST + TARGET_CFLAGS +=-DIOPSYS_TEST +endif + define Package/libdsl SECTION:=libs CATEGORY:=Libraries